Output 3ae2291feffcf62a0eab8e8d6a7ebc321e65e0edf1dfc100e10049dacf0909f6:7

value
2587525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ba6c042ec03e6e289ccef0d89f1af51f9095ba OP_EQUAL
address
3C4Mc3WCT7pcdQRgXa6UhhB97DUyjzuunr
transaction
3ae2291feffcf62a0eab8e8d6a7ebc321e65e0edf1dfc100e10049dacf0909f6
spent
true